John Henry MITCHELL

MITCHELL, John Henry

Service Number: 8080
Last Rank: Private
Last Unit: 4th Field Ambulance
Home Town: Lambton, Newcastle, New South Wales
Died: Died of wounds, France, 8 August 1918, age not yet discovered
Cemetery: Daours Communal Cemetery Extension, France
Daours Communal Cemetery Extension, Daours, Picardie, France
Memorials: Australian War Memorial Roll of Honour, Lambton Fallen Soldiers HR
